Wizkid becomes first African artiste to surpass 11 billion Spotify streams

Wizkid has made global  music history after becoming the first African artiste to surpass 11 billion streams across all credits on Spotify.

The milestone cements his status as one of the most streamed African musicians of all time, following a steady rise driven by a decade of hit records, global collaborations, and chart-topping projects.

Wizkid’s streaming dominance is powered by major international successes such as “One Dance” with Drake and Kyla, as well as his critically acclaimed catalog including “Essence” featuring Tems and his award-winning album Made in Lagos (Deluxe).

The achievement also builds on his previous record as the first African artist to hit 10 billion Spotify streams earlier in 2

026, highlighting his continued growth on the global stage.
